What Causes Frost In Frost Free Freezer . Freezer frost is primarily caused by the intrusion of warm, humid air into the freezer, and this can happen in many different ways. what causes freezer frost? freezer frost results from frozen moisture accumulated on your appliance’s interior walls and shelves. It occurs when “moisture comes into contact with the evaporator coils inside your freezer and then freezes,” according to general electric. what is freezer frost, and what causes it? if your freezer looks like it's been hit by a snowstorm, it's time to find out why there's so much frost in there. You’ll have to start by manually clearing away the frost build up so you can start your own thorough investigation. Discover how to fix the problem yourself. Accumulated frozen moisture on the interior walls and shelves of your appliance is commonly known as freezer frost. frost located in the back of your freezer may signal a problem in the evaporator coil, one of the sensor systems, or another. frost can appear around the fan and cause it to slow down or stop completely so cold air can’t flow through the cabinet.
